X-Git-Url: http://review.tizen.org/git/?a=blobdiff_plain;f=atk%2Fatkplug.h;h=b1d83ffc3de05607dfb71055dc6b4751e6fbb69f;hb=4f631cf8b3ceb2d8e8342850a0124426faa0a0c7;hp=7d6efd4b9d21575ae2f7e5df6f985bcdacacd436;hpb=050183b2fdb854a4efb9ac3e00511a8d64179a70;p=platform%2Fupstream%2Fatk.git diff --git a/atk/atkplug.h b/atk/atkplug.h index 7d6efd4..b1d83ff 100644 --- a/atk/atkplug.h +++ b/atk/atkplug.h @@ -17,12 +17,14 @@ * Boston, MA 02111-1307, USA. */ +#ifndef __ATK_PLUG_H__ +#define __ATK_PLUG_H__ + #if defined(ATK_DISABLE_SINGLE_INCLUDES) && !defined (__ATK_H_INSIDE__) && !defined (ATK_COMPILATION) #error "Only can be included directly." #endif -#ifndef __ATK_PLUG_H__ -#define __ATK_PLUG_H__ +#include G_BEGIN_DECLS @@ -41,6 +43,7 @@ struct _AtkPlug AtkObject parent; }; +ATK_AVAILABLE_IN_ALL GType atk_plug_get_type (void); struct _AtkPlugClass @@ -53,7 +56,9 @@ struct _AtkPlugClass gchar* (* get_object_id) (AtkPlug* obj); }; +ATK_AVAILABLE_IN_ALL AtkObject* atk_plug_new (void); +ATK_AVAILABLE_IN_ALL gchar* atk_plug_get_id (AtkPlug* plug); G_END_DECLS